About the Role

Reporting to the Finance Manager – Indirect Sales, this position is responsible for accurate and timely completion of sales account planning and month end close for the US consumer business. This position will work closely with the Sales Team providing dedicated support at an account/channel level to understand financial performance and drive decisions to maximize profit.

·       Month End Close, Forecasting and Reporting

·       Prepare, review and confirm accuracy of promotional expense accruals for month end by customer and category they support

·       Provide dedicated support to accounts/channels to ensure operational plans are properly accounted for and included in forecast/budget process

·       Support Finance Manager – Indirect Sales during annual budgeting process by driving key insights on accounts/channels they support

·       Help drive process improvements/automation in order to free up capacity for additional business partnering initiatives

·       Serve as a business partner to the US Sales Team

·       Build strong relationships and provide value added advice to Sales Team to ensure financial results are well understood and business results optimized

·       Partner with Sales and Demand teams to ensure plans at an account/channel level have been vetted financially

·       Perform ad-hoc financial analysis and special projects as requested; i.e. ROI analysis to support promotional investment decisions

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
